CVE-2017-2862
An exploitable heap overflow vulnerability exists in the gdkpixbufjpegimageloadincrement functionality of Gdk-Pixbuf 2.36.6. A specially crafted jpeg file can cause a heap overflow resulting in remote code execution. An attacker can send a file or url to trigger this vulnerability...

CVE-2017-13769
The WriteTHUMBNAILImage function in coders/thumbnail.c in ImageMagick through 7.0.6-10 allows an attacker to cause a denial of service buffer over-read by sending a crafted JPEG file...
